Yesterday I repainted some of the Zong’s old plastic with Krylon Fusion Camouflage Ultra Flat Khaki spray paint. Below is a photograph of the repainted plastic, after it had dried for 24 hours.
I can report that Krylon Fusion Camouflage paint is very easy to apply, and it produces a nice flat finish. However, as you can see, Krylon has changed the color from the khaki posted on their website; the actual color is now more of a “battleship gray.†Based upon these results, I can project my Zong repainted in Krylon Camo “Khaki†would look similar to the retouched photographs posted below. I'm still making up my mind; what do you think? Spud
